Job description
WebKit is the open source browser engine that powers Safari, Mail, and many other applications across iOS, macOS, and visionOS. As a Performance Infrastructure Engineer for WebKit, you will build and maintain critical tools that enable our team to track, investigate, and prevent performance regressions across all Apple platforms., Our Performance Infrastructure team builds the tooling and infrastructure that enables WebKit engineers to monitor performance metrics and investigate regressions. As WebKit evolves, our infrastructure provides the visibility needed to detect and diagnose performance changes., Weāre looking for an engineer to evolve our performance monitoring and testing infrastructure. Youāll own and improve the systems that power our performance testing and analysis workflows, and your work will directly impact how WebKit engineers detect and diagnose regressions.ā,āresponsibilitiesā:āOwn and maintain a performance monitoring dashboard that tracks WebKit performance metrics and manages A/B testing.
Maintain and enhance tools for performance tracking and A/B testing.
Develop and improve benchmarking systems and measurement tools.

- RSU, At Apple, base pay is one part of our total compensation package and is determined within a range. This provides the opportunity to progress as you grow and develop within a role. The base pay range for this role is between $147,400 and $272,100, and your base pay will depend on your skills, qualifications, experience, and location.
Apple employees also have the opportunity to become an Apple shareholder through participation in Appleās discretionary employee stock programs. Apple employees are eligible for discretionary restricted stock unit awards, and can purchase Apple stock at a discount if voluntarily participating in Appleās Employee Stock Purchase Plan. Youāll also receive benefits including: Comprehensive medical and dental coverage, retirement benefits, a range of discounted products and free services, and for formal education related to advancing your career at Apple, reimbursement for certain educational expenses - including tuition.
